Packaging Details
Packaging Details for Coffee Beans:
Standard Packaging (Bulk):
Bags: Jute or burlap sacks lined with a plastic interior to protect against moisture and preserve the beans\' freshness.
Weight per Bag: 60 kg (standard) or customizable from 25 to 60 kg depending on buyer requirements.
Labeling: Each bag will have a label with details like product name (Arabica/Robusta), grade, weight, batch number, origin (Karnataka, Kerala, Tamil Nadu), and any buyer-specific information.
Smaller Quantities (Specialty Coffee Buyers):
Bags: High-barrier, multi-layer vacuum-sealed bags with an optional one-way degassing valve to release gases while keeping the beans fresh.
Weight per Bag: 250g, 500g, 1kg, or 5kg (for smaller retail buyers).
Labeling: Customizable branding and labeling available, including origin, variety, roast date, flavor notes, and grade.
Export-Grade Packaging (Bulk Orders):
Jute Bags (60 kg): Used for large orders, lined with polyethylene to ensure moisture resistance and freshness.
Big Bags: For very large quantities, 1-ton capacity flexible intermediate bulk containers (FIBCs) are available.
Vacuum-Sealed Bags: For specialty coffee exports that require longer shelf life, available in 1kg or 5kg bags.
Container Load:
20 ft Container: Approximately 19-20 metric tons of coffee beans in 60 kg sacks.
40 ft Container: Approximately 38-40 metric tons of coffee beans in 60 kg sacks.
Custom Packaging:
Packaging and labeling can be customized based on buyer preferences, including branded packaging for retail buyers.
Packaging Considerations:
Ensure airtight and moisture-proof packaging to maintain the flavor and quality of the beans during transit.
Eco-friendly options such as biodegradable jute or paper bags can be offered for buyers focused on sustainability.
